With two weeks to go until the NCAA Tournament selection show, the college baseball field of 64 is still wide open.
This season lacks a clear dominant team the way Tennessee was in 2022 or Wake Forest in 2023. Texas (40-10, 20-7 SEC) is still projected as the No. 1 overall seed, despite back-to-back series losses, because of its two-game lead in the SEC standings as well as a stellar 15-9 Quadrant 1 record.
Six of the top eight projected national seeds this week are from the SEC, with other teams lacking the typical resumes to be a national seed. The list of hosting candidates thins out at the bottom as well. Tennessee (39-13, 15-12 SEC) and TCU (35-16, 17-10 Big 12) get the nods this time over Clemson (38-15, 15-12 ACC); Georgia Tech (37-15, 17-10 ACC) and West Virginia (40-10, 19-6 Big 12).
On the bubble, several mid-major teams are staking their cases. Western Kentucky (41-10, 17-7 Conference USA) and Xavier (30-23, 14-7 Big East) get the nod over Cal Poly (34-16, 20-7 Big West) and Southeastern Louisiana (36-14, 22-8 Southland) due to better RPI and Quadrant 1 and 2 records.
Virginia (30-16, 14-10 ACC) has played its way back into a spot on the bubble. A preseason top-five team, the Cavaliers are just 60th in RPI, but they had a weekend series at Florida State canceled due to a shooting on campus. As such, they receive more leeway in the RPI in this projection, as the RPI would be higher had they faced the Seminoles.
